Defining the Role of a Quantity Surveyor

A quantity surveyor manages the financial and contractual aspects of construction projects. They prepare cost estimates, conduct feasibility studies, oversee procurement and control budgets from project inception to completion.

Quantity surveyors work closely with architects, engineers, contractors and clients to deliver value for money.

Why Quantity Surveyors Matter

Quantity surveyors help prevent cost overruns and ensure that resources are used efficiently. Their expertise contributes to the financial success of projects and helps manage risks related to budgeting and contracts.

For clients and contractors, quantity surveyors provide clarity and control over project expenses.

Typical Responsibilities of Quantity Surveyors

Quantity surveyors prepare detailed cost plans, manage tender processes, evaluate contractor bids and negotiate contracts. They monitor costs during construction, certify payments and handle variations and claims.

They also provide advice on procurement strategies and dispute resolution.

Skills and Qualifications

Successful quantity surveyors have strong numerical, analytical and negotiation skills. Many hold degrees in quantity surveying or construction management and professional membership with the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ors (RICS) is highly regarded.

Career Progression and Opportunities

Quantity surveying offers clear pathways for career advancement. Starting as a trainee or junior surveyor, individuals can progress to senior roles, project management or specialised consultancy. Many quantity surveyors also move into related fields such as commercial management or property development. Continuous professional development and gaining chartered status with RICS enhance career prospects and earning potential.
